This isn't a bug, but is related to a rule in Backgammon that says if you make a roll BOTH dice must be used (if possible). You moved the six from the 9pt to the 3pt, BUT this doesn't allow you to use the three. However you can use both dice if you move from the 24pt to the 18pt, and then move from the 18pt to the 15pt. This is actually the only valid move. To undo your move from 9 to 3 you can use Control-Z or drag the piece you put on the 3pt and put it back to the 9pt and then make the legal move above.

More about this rule (and others) can be found here: http://www.bkgm.com/rules.html . In particular the rule that comes into play can be found at that link under "Movement of the Checkers" that says:

"4. A player must use both numbers of a roll if this is legally possible (or all four numbers of a double). When only one number can be played, the player must play that number. Or if either number can be played but not both, the player must play the larger one. When neither number can be used, the player loses his turn. In the case of doubles, when all four numbers cannot be played, the player must play as many numbers as he can. "
